A Quick Chicken and Rice Meal for Busy Nights!
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 0 Minutes
Cook Time: 20 Minutes
Ready In: 20 Minutes
Servings: 4
Adapted from a Campbell's recipe to make it a little more waist friendly!
Ingredients:
cooking spray
4 boneless chicken breasts, pounded a little to flatten
1 (10 3/4 ounce) can low-fat cream of chicken soup
1 1/2 cups water (or broth or low fat milk)
1/4 teaspoon paprika
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der (optional)
2 cups cooked brown rice
2 cups broccoli florets (fresh or frozen)
Directions:
1. Spray skillet with cooking spray. Add chicken and cook until browned. Set chicken aside.
2. Add the cream of chicken soup, water, paprika, pepper and garlic powder to the skillet. Heat to a boil.
3. Stir in the cooked rice and broccoli. Top with the chicken. Season the chicken with some more paprika and pepper. Cover and cook over low heat about 5-7 minutes, until heated through. Good served with a nice salad and some rolls. Enjoy!
